Welcome to 411’s WWE Smackdown Report 10.17.14

* Seth Rollins kicks off the show for tonight’s opening talky segment. He gets the you sold out chants, so he discusses that when you’re young and naïve your principles mean the world to you, but the one thing that people tend to forget is that honor doesn’t pay the bills. He said that the crowd should be like him and sell their souls to do so. Selling out is the best thing that you can do in life, for him, it led to him becoming the future of the WWE. He then discussed Hell in a Cell, noting that Ambrose didn’t belong there, but instead belonged in a straightjacket. He’ll let Ambrose walk into Hell in a Cell, but he will left him lying in a pile at the end of the night. Dolph Ziggler then came out. Don’t do it Dolph, go to the back, this cannot end well. We saw the replay of Rollins curb stomping Ziggler on Raw. Ziggler said that when you sellout for fame and money, you are left without self-respect. And self-respect is priceless. Rollins said that self-respect and showing off won’t help Ziggler tonight, but then Ziggler dropkicked him. The ref was able to get them separated, and now we begin our opening match…

Non-Title Match: Dolph Ziggler © vs. Seth Rollins: And here we go. Ziggler is the house of fire, hitting a backdrop and then sending Rollins to the floor as we head to a commercial…

Back from commercial as Rollins sends Ziggler to the buckle, he bumps chest first and then Rollins with the suplex and a cover gets 2. Rollins grounds Ziggler with a million dollar dream, but Ziggler battles to his feet and escapes. He charges, but Rollins with the flatliner into the buckles. Rollins keeps control, stomping on the hand of Ziggler and then stepping on it. Knees to the gut by Rollins follow and then he slaps Ziggler in the back of the head a few times. Off the ropes, Ziggler sidesteps and sends Rollins to the floor. Rollins “tweaks” his knee and Ziggler attacks and slams him to the barricade. He tries to work the knee off the post, but Rollins pulls Ziggler into the post instead. Back into the ring they go, Rollins up top but Ziggler is able to run up and get the super X-Factor! Ziggler covers for 2 as we head to a commercial…

Back from commercial, Rollins misses the corner dive and both men are down. To their feet, and a clothesline by Ziggler. Corner mounted rights follow and then a neck breaker. Elbow drop by Ziggler and a cover gets 2. Rollins to the apron, Ziggler goes after him but gets stun gunned off the ropes. Rollins up top, Ziggler up with him again but Rollins tries a sunset flip powerbomb, which Ziggler counters into a DDT, the cover gets 2. Both try to get to their feet, they do, Rollins counters the zigzag, Ziggler avoids the curb stomp and gets a sunset flip for 2. Rollins then muscles Ziggler up ad hits the buckle bomb and curb stomp and that is all.

Your Intercontinental Champion ladies and gentlemen; beaten on last week’s Smackdown, beaten on Monday’s Raw and then beaten again tonight.

OFFICIAL RESULT: Seth Rollins @ 11:30 via pin

* Post match, Dean Ambrose appeared. Rollins was in the ring with the briefcase, but Ambrose had the contract that was supposed to be inside. Ambrose said he just wanted to talk, and said he planned to make the most of Rollins when he had him trapped at Hell in a Cell. As Ambrose was about to talk more, Kane came out to ruin everything in wrestling in 2014. Kane likes hurting people and killing the joy of wrestling fans, so they made Ambrose vs. Kane for tonight.

Non-Title Match: AJ Lee © vs. Layla: AJ cut a mini-box promo, she loves the Diva’s Title. Lock up, AJ works the arm but Layla hits a back elbow. Off the ropes, AJ battles back and shoots Layla to the corner and then hits a spin kick and covers for 2. Kick to the gut by AJ and a neck breaker follows. She hits another and covers for 2. off the ropes, a kick by Layla and another drops AJ. Layla slams her to the corner, shoves AJ to the mat and then gets the figure four head scissors. AJ counters and escapes, side headlock by Layla, AJ escapes and then runs into a boot. Layla misses a high cross, and AJ locks in the black widow and that is all.

OFFICIAL RESULT: AJ Lee @ 1:59 via submission

* Post match Alicia Fox attacked AJ, but AJ was able to fight her off. Paige then kicked AJ in the face and laid her out with the Ram-Paige.

Dean Ambrose vs. Kane w/Seth Rollins: Kane with rights to begin, a boot follows and then tries a slam. Ambrose slides out, the floor and faces off with Rollins. Kane tried to sneak up on him, but Ambrose knew it and got back into the ring. Both back in, boots to Kane in the corner by Ambrose. Kane fights back and lands rights in the corner. Ambrose fires back, hits a dropkick and tosses Kane to the floor. He invites Rollins into the ring, Kane charges, and Ambrose low bridges him and sends him to the floor. Ambrose with the slingshot plancha and wipes out Kane. Ambrose lays the boots to Kane as he slides back in, looks for the tornado DDT but Kane tosses him across the ring and then hits the big boot. Kane tosses Ambrose to the floor, slams him to the barricade and then the apron repeatedly. Kane then slams the hand of Ambrose off of the steps a few times, and rolls him back in. Uppercut by Kane follows and then Kane chokes out Ambrose in the corner. Kane works the arm in the ropes, more punches follow and then Kane slams Ambrose to the mat and covers for 2. Kane continues to work the arm as Rollins watches on. Ambrose bites Kane’s hand to escape, so Kane tosses him to the floor. Kane follows and Ambrose then slams him head first to the steps. A running kick by Ambrose sends Kane back first into the steps. Ambrose back in, and then flies to the floor with the suicide dive. Ambrose rolls Kane in, heads up top and leaps in with the missile dropkick. Ambrose follows with a corner forearm and bulldog. Ambrose covers for 2. Ambrose looks for the double underhook DDT, Rollins distracts but Ambrose takes him out. Goes for the jawbreaker lariat but Rollins pulls him to the floor for the DQ…

Seriously, Dean Ambrose can’t beat Citizen Fucking Kane clean one week before Hell in a Cell?

OFFICIAL RESULT: Dean Ambrose @ 5:57 via DQ

* Post match, Rollins continued the attack and hit a buckle bomb on Ambrose. He set up a chair for a curb stomp, Kane was helping but Ambrose fought back and put a stop to that noise. Rollins was able to escape as Ambrose laid in some chair shots to the back of Kane before he rolled out of the ring. Ambrose stood tall and had a long distance stare down with Rollins.
